## Deployment

Hooklet retries failed webhook deliveries with exponential backoff: 5 attempts, capped at 10 minutes, then dead-letter. Plugin authors: your endpoint must return 2xx within the timeout or the attempt counts as failed. Idempotency keys are sent on every retry. Deployments ship with the following default retry configuration.

deployment values, yadug-bawif:
[framir]
team = pelox
access_code = ac_a38ab2
owner = tamion.julael
host = framir.tolvaqlabs.test
port = 11211
peer = tammir.zemvargrid.local
salt = 2215ef03
pin = 1541

Subject: Key rotation — Plowlink telemetry gateway

Hey all, quick heads-up for the sync: we rotated the ingest key for the Plowlink gateway this morning after the quarterly audit. Old key dies Friday, so update any tractors-in-the-lab test rigs before then. Staging already switched over cleanly. For everyone wiring up local harnesses, the new key is below.

API key for yahig-tadup: kto7_ubizbYm

**Alert: Parity gap — Fernglass JS vs. Fernglass Python SDK.** Fires when the weekly contract check finds endpoints or options supported in one SDK but missing in the other. Treat as a warning, not an outage. First step: check whether the gap is already tracked; most are. If new, file a parity ticket against the owning SDK and note it in the alert thread. Do not patch both SDKs in one change. The parity tracker and filing instructions live on the page below.

wiki page, bajog-tahop: https://confluence.qorvelsys.internal/browse/pages/pages/pages

### Step 4: Enable the bloom filter on Kestrel-KV

Deploy the `kv-bloom` sidecar ahead of the Kestrel store. It screens lookups and cuts misses hitting disk by roughly 80%. Set the false-positive rate to 0.01 and size the filter from current keyspace counts. Pull those counts from the metadata database, connecting with the string below.

replica DSN, tawef-hahap: mysql://eliix_svc:FiIC0jz@db-394a.lumiclabs.internal:5432/holius